I think it depends entirely on the individual firm's academic criteria. The firms you have listed do appear to have relatively strict academic requirements, with expectations around achieving a 2:1 in each module rather than just a 2:1 or above overall. If these requirements are applied strictly, a single 2:2 module could potentially mean you don't meet their eligibility criteria (even though you have a 2:1 overall).

However, if you are particularly motivated to apply to one of those firms, I wouldn't necessarily rule yourself out without checking. It may be worth emailing the graduate recruitment team to explain your situation and ask whether your results would still be considered, especially if there were any circumstances that affected that particular module.

For firms without those specific requirements, I wouldn't worry too much about one module grade. A strong overall 2:1, combined with good experiences and a well-prepared application, is still a strong profile for many firms.
